My, It's Been A Long Long Time | Greensboro Coliseum, 6/ 30/76 | 2 Red LP + CD (rare out of print) In 1976 Elvis rocked the Greensboro Coliseum 5 times. Obviously most memorable is the April 14, 1972, performance which is considered to be one of his best performances. But more than 4 years later Elvis still delivered a high-quality show in Greensboro.
